The Global Vegetable Wax Market faces several challenges, including fluctuating raw material prices, limited availability of specific types of vegetable waxes, and the competition from synthetic alternatives. The volatility of prices for raw materials such as soybean, palm, and rapeseed oils can impact the overall production costs and profitability for manufacturers. Additionally, certain types of vegetable waxes, such as carnauba wax, are in limited supply due to factors like climate change and sustainability concerns. Moreover, the market faces competition from synthetic waxes that offer similar properties at a lower cost, posing a threat to the growth of the vegetable wax market. Overall, navigating these challenges requires market players to focus on sustainable sourcing practices, product innovation, and strategic pricing strategies.

Government policies related to the Global Vegetable Wax Market vary by country, with some implementing regulations to promote sustainable sourcing and production of vegetable wax. For example, the European Union has enacted directives such as the Renewable Energy Directive and the Sustainable Development Goals to encourage the use of renewable resources like vegetable wax in various industries. In the United States, the Department of Agriculture provides support for farmers growing crops used in the production of vegetable wax through programs like the Conservation Reserve Program. Additionally, some countries have established certification schemes like the Roundtable on Sustainable Palm Oil (RSPO) to ensure the responsible sourcing of vegetable wax from crops like palm oil. Overall, government policies aim to foster a more environmentally friendly and sustainable Global Vegetable Wax Market.
